  7. here's what I think BioWare is doing wrong.. My server, Dark Reaper, was one of the most populated servers at launch (constant Heavy status). Now it is always at light. Nowadays, Republic side has an average of 18-20 ppl on the fleet at ANY given time (peak playing times can go up to 40!) However, the IMP side is not feeling the effects as badly as the Republic side on my server. Imp side has nearly 60-80 people on at a time at the fleet and maybe even over a 100 during peak times. I really really hope that bioware is not dumb enough to look at the server population as a whole and think "hey this isn't too bad." One faction is CLEARLY suffering a GREAT deal more than the other... they need to do something about this asap. I have a main 50 Guardian, 50 Gunslinger, 50 Shadow and a few other republic alts that I feel I must abandon to begin leveling a Jugg on the same server just so I can get some games/interaction going on. Hopefully I can transfer my Guardian's gear through the legacy items/system so the grinding won't be as painful on my jugg.

  10. I am still enjoying this game very much but the thing that's bothering me is the lack of players. I play mainly on Dark Reaper (which was one of the most populated West Coast PVP servers at launch). After 1.2 lotta people returned, and the fleet was seeing 100+. In the past week, there have been an average of 20-30 people on at the fleet. Right now, at 2:21 PM there were only 18 people. I'm logging in to hopefully get some fun pvp action but that's not happening. FPs aren't happening. The only thing left to do is the mindless, repetitive, daily grind for what? What's the daliy commendations going to be good for when there's nobody to play with? Sad thing is that my current guild has more players online at a time than does the Fleet. PvP queues are averaging 30-40 minutes with most games starting with less players making the entire match seem hopeless... I log on wanting to play and see the lowly population and immediately log off. I already have 3 50s and other alts so that's already done. BioWare needs to make server transfers/merges priority #1 because at this rate, the game is going to be completely dead by the end of May.
